Licensing, Safety, and Trust: The Non-Negotiables

Any worthwhile shortlist starts with licensing. In the UK, the gold standard is a valid UKGC licence from the Gambling Commission. This oversight forces operators to meet stringent standards around fair play, marketing conduct, KYC/AML checks, and handling of player funds. Licensed casinos must segregate player balances, publish clear terms, and respond to disputes via approved ADRs. If a brand ducks these fundamentals, it’s not a contender. Always verify the licence number on the footer and cross-check it on the Commission’s public register.

Beyond licensing, the best UK online casinos build their reputation on verifiable fairness and responsible play. Look for independent testing by organisations such as eCOGRA or iTech Labs, which audit RNGs and payout percentages. Responsible gambling is more than a footer badge; it means practical tools like configurable deposit, loss, and session limits, reality checks, time-outs, and self-exclusion via GAMSTOP. Connections to GamCare and BeGambleAware, plus detailed help pages, indicate an operator that treats player wellbeing as a core duty rather than an afterthought.

Security is equally critical. End-to-end encryption, secure account recovery, and optional two-factor authentication protect personal and banking data. Transparent privacy policies demonstrate GDPR-aware stewardship of customer information. On the payments side, robust verification ties to safer gambling: effective KYC prevents misuse, and sensible affordability controls discourage harmful play. When safety, fairness, and privacy converge, trust follows—and trust is the invisible foundation that separates a merely good site from a truly great one.

Games, RTP, and Promotions: Value Without the Gimmicks

What fills the lobby matters as much as how it’s regulated. Elite brands curate a balanced catalogue from top studios—Evolution for live dealer tables and game shows; Play’n GO, NetEnt, Pragmatic Play, Red Tiger, and Games Global for high-performing slots; and Playtech or Authentic for alternative live experiences. A healthy library includes classic slots, modern features (e.g., cluster pays, hold-and-spin), and progressive jackpots like Age of the Gods. Table game purists should find multiple roulette and blackjack variants, side bets, and realistic betting windows that suit casuals and high rollers alike.

For long-term value, focus on published RTP data and transparent rules. The best operators highlight game RTPs (often around 96% for slots, higher for certain table games with optimal strategy) and avoid stealthy “low-RTP” versions. Live dealer streams should be crisp, with consistent uptime and professional hosts. Search tools, volatility tags, and demo modes all help players make informed choices without guesswork. The result is a lobby where discovery feels exciting, not exhausting.

Promotions must reward, not restrict. Strong welcome offers feature reasonable wagering (e.g., 25x–35x on bonus funds), clear game weighting, fair expiry windows, and no hidden max-win traps. Wager-free spins or cashback provide unambiguous value. Ongoing incentives—reloads, prize drops, tournaments, and loyalty tiers—should be achievable for regular players rather than whales only. E-wallet exclusions, max-bet limits while wagering, and jackpot exclusions are normal, but they must be boldly stated, not buried. The best UK online casinos make T&Cs digestible, so players spend time enjoying games instead of decoding fine print.

Mobile UX, Banking, and Real-World Choices: Mini Case Studies

With most sessions now happening on phones, mobile execution is a decisive differentiator. A top-tier site loads fast on 4G/5G, keeps navigation thumb-friendly, and presents live game thumbnails and search filters without clutter. Whether via a progressive web app or a native iOS/Android app, frictionless onboarding and identity verification are crucial. Look for in-app document uploads, instant OCR checks, and helpful prompts that explain what’s needed and why. The strongest brands provide real-time session reminders and easy access to limits from the account menu, making responsible gambling tools truly usable on small screens.

Banking paints another clear picture. UK rules prohibit credit cards for gambling, so reliable alternatives matter: fast debit card pay-outs, PayPal, Apple Pay, Paysafecard, and bank transfers via Open Banking. Elite operators process withdrawals swiftly—often within minutes to a few hours for e-wallets and same-day for bank transfers once verification is complete. Weekends shouldn’t stall pay-outs, and communication about pending withdrawals must be proactive. If an operator repeatedly requests unnecessary documents or resets checks mid-withdrawal, consider it a red flag.
